Physical properties

Dark brown-gray, fine-grained, dull to slightly earthy luster, with possible subtle vesicles and weathering rind; hardness about 5–6 Mohs, generally massive with no obvious cleavage, specific gravity about 2.8–3.0.

Formation & geological history

An extrusive igneous rock formed when mafic lava cooled rapidly at or near Earth’s surface, commonly during volcanic eruptions. The brown surface reflects oxidation and chemical weathering; its exact age cannot be determined from the image.

Uses & applications

Basalt is widely used as crushed aggregate, road material, riprap, dimension stone, and occasionally in landscaping; ordinary fragments have negligible jewelry value.

Geological facts

Basalt is the most common volcanic rock and makes up much of oceanic crust. It commonly contains microscopic crystals that may be difficult to see without magnification.

Field identification & locations

Identify it by its dark color, fine texture, high density, and lack of visible quartz; a streak test is usually gray, and it should not fizz with dilute hydrochloric acid unless carbonate alteration is present. Common in volcanic regions and glacial or stream deposits worldwide.
